Common questions

Do I have to be Eritrean to join?
No. Partners, friends and supporters of the community are welcome to join as members.
What if $25 is difficult right now?
Email us. We have never turned anyone away over the fee, and the conversation stays between you and the treasurer.
When does membership run?
From the day you join through to 31 December. We send a reminder before it lapses.
Where does the fee go?
Venues, permits, insurance, food at community events and the youth programs. Nobody at ECA is paid. Full accounts are presented to members at the AGM, and you can see what we are working on at any time on the projects board.
